Shimla is located in the northern state of Himachal Pradesh. It is easily amongst the top three hill stations in the entire country and attracts people from all over the globe, every time of the year. Shimla is one of the best summer retreats in India, the highlight of the place being its climate. The average temperature during the summer months is 15 degrees and that during winter is 4-5 degrees. Gangtok is the capital city of Sikkim and is located in the eastern Himalayan ranges. The city lies at an altitude of nearly 1800 meters and is a wonderful place that is characterized by a unique beauty of its own. Major attractions in Gangtok are the Tsongma Lake, Do-Drul, Chorten Stupa which is the biggest stupa in Sikkim, the Alpine gardens, the deer park and the Himalayan zoological park.
